Kathy M. Vassallie (nee Scrivanich), 70, of Long Branch, passed away Monday surrounded by her family.
Kathy was born at Fort Benning in Georgia and moved to New Jersey in her childhood. She graduated from Ocean Township High School and began her career at Shadow Lawn Bank. Kathy married the love of her life, Raymond P. Vassallie Sr., in 1984. The two settled in Long Branch to raise their young family. After starting her family, Kathy switched careers and began a new endeavor at Monmouth Medical Center. Due to her hard work and dedication throughout her thirty-year tenure at the hospital, Kathy scaled the ranks, eventually becoming a Radiology Department supervisor.
While she thrived in her work at the hospital, she found the greatest joy in being a mom and a grandma. Kathy loved traveling and spending time with her family. She was always the mom who cheered the loudest in the stands at all of her children’s events. Her many life lessons serve as her legacy as she instilled important values into her children.
Kathy has been described as vibrant, charismatic, and a force to be reckoned with. Despite most of her life being spent in New Jersey, Kathy’s southern roots always shined through. She knew the true meaning of hospitality and always loved meeting new people. She always knew how to make people feel at ease. Even standing in line at the grocery store, within minutes Kathy would be chatting with the person next to her as if they were old friends. She always knew exactly what to say in any situation, whether charming new acquaintances or advocating for those around her. She was never afraid to use her voice and imposing 5’9” stature to right an injustice.
